Between the 1950s and the 1990s, bed bugs weren’t much of a problem in the United States, but things have changed, and more and more people are finding these nuisance pests in their homes and apartments. Many people believe a bed bug infestation is indicative of a messy, cluttered space. This, however, is a common misconception. Bed bugs are notorious hitchhikers and will find their way from spaces such as schools, hotels, public transportation, movie theaters, or used clothing stores into almost any home.
